Microsoft announces Sam Altman’s arrival, Satya Nadella

On Monday, Sam Altman rejoined Microsoft, following his dismissal as CEO a few days prior.”We remain committed to our partnership with OpenAI and have confidence in our product roadmap, our ability to continue to innovate with everything we announced at Microsoft Ignite, and in continuing to support our customers and partners,”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ella wrote on X to announce Altman’s appointment.

“We are excited to collaborate with Emmett Shear and OAI’s new leadership group.” Furthermore, we are thrilled to announce that Sam Altman, Greg Brockman, and associates will be joining Microsoft to head a brand-new advanced AI research team. The CEO of Microsoft wrote, “We look forward to moving quickly to provide them with the resources needed for their success.”

Earlier in the day, OpenAI rejected investor demands to reinstall Altman and instead appointed Emmett Shear, the former CEO of Twitch, as the new CEO.

The business that developed ChatGPT, OpenAI, fired Altman on Saturday, citing a lack of trust in his abilities to steer the AI startup financed by Microsoft.

The board of the business expressed its gratitude for Sam’s numerous contributions to the establishment and development of OpenAI in a statement. However, we think that as we proceed, new leadership will be required.
